    How Do You Determine Your Pickleball Rating and Skill?

    Finding out how to determine your pickleball rating involves a mix of self-assessment and familiarity with the system that ranks players. Every player needs to calculateIt’s their skill level accurately to ensure fair and competitive play.

    First, you’ll need to review the criteria of the skill levels, which typically vary from beginners at 1.0 to pro players at 5.0 and above. Then, you should self-evaluate your proficiency in various aspects of the game—serve, return, strategy, and consistency, to get a sense of where you stand.

    Finally, it’s a good idea to play with different players who have known ratings to see how you compare.

    As your skill improves, you’ll want to regularly calculate and update your ranking to reflect your current level of play within the pickleball community.



    The Role of DUPR in Assessing Pickleball Skill Levels

    The DUPR (Dynamic Universal Pickleball Rating(2)) stands as a pivotal system for skill assessment, crucial for players to understand their current standing and potential for growth. By offering a dynamic pickleball rating, DUPR seamlessly quantifies a player’s prowess, ensuring that pickleball ratings are an accurate reflection of their ability.

    This inclusivity in ratings allows for a thorough level evaluation, enabling players at all skill levels to track progress and set goals. The DUPR system incorporates an array of matches and scenarios, which means your pickleball rating will evolve as you do, offering an ever-adjusting gauge of your true skill.

    Determining your pickleball rating involves analysis of both your victories and challenges, as DUPR considers the nuance of each game. Thus, ascertaining your level through this astute system enhances the sport’s integrity, providing a consistent scale across the pickleball community.
